Mobials & Black Book Celebrate Success of New App

New online tool was built by Mobials, and is powered by Canadian Black Book.

In three months, over 200 Canadian dealers have signed on to use Tradesii, a new online service that provides consumers with trade-in information about their vehicles, while in turn creating leads for local dealers.

Consumers are offered the opportunity to look up their trade-in value in exchange for providing their contact information. The Tradesii report also includes the average asking price of similar vehicles that are listed on CanadianBlackBook.com so that they can see what their vehicle would list for at retail. The lead is passed to the dealer along with the specifics on vehicles searched during the website visit.

Tradesii was launched in April as an on-site trade-in valuation tool for dealers on Kijiji.ca. Early results suggest that approximately ten per cent of leads generated from Kijiji are coming directly through Tradesii, and according to Mobials, Tradesii has become the primary source for qualified leads and high-value new trade-ins for some dealers.

“This early success can be attributed to a few things. Our data, provided by Canadian Black Book is second to none, based on Canadian figures and consumers trust that, coupled with a widget that offers a far superior customer experience versus what exists on most dealer sites today,” says Marty Meadows, President, Mobials. “Plus the app was designed 100 per cent from the dealers’ perspective, to deliver a flexible tool that optimizes website visits and puts more and better leads into the hopper.”

“The simple format and logic of this tool give it some real legs, as we are seeing already,” says Brad Rome, President, Canadian Black Book. “Our role in this partnership is not only to provide accurate data, but also lend the strength and trust in our brand to provide comfort to both consumers and dealers.”
